Output e388dec8f02ccf0f9a65b5546f82728aab23fb3d4baa5d17435b0095852a7581:3

value
5311
script pubkey
OP_0 OP_PUSHBYTES_20 665d65f419def5c355620829e7b28995e5d49350
address
tb1qvewktaqemm6ux4tzpq570v5fjhjafy6s64f5ja
transaction
e388dec8f02ccf0f9a65b5546f82728aab23fb3d4baa5d17435b0095852a7581
confirmations
34342
spent
true